    Getting There

    Walking

    If you are in Rock Sound, start at the Rock Sound Fish Fry area, which is a popular spot for local food and culture. From there, head southeast on Queen's Highway (the main road). Continue walking for about 1.5 miles until you reach a fork in the road. Take the left fork which leads to a dirt road. This is a less traveled route, so make sure to stay on the path. After about another mile, you will see a sign that indicates the direction to Cathedral Cave. Follow the signs and keep walking until you reach the entrance of the cave.

    Bicycle

    Rent a bicycle from a local shop in Rock Sound. Start at the Rock Sound Fish Fry area and follow the same route as the walking directions. The bike ride will take you about 15-20 minutes. After reaching the fork in the road, take the left fork towards the dirt road. Continue cycling for about a mile until you see the sign for Cathedral Cave. Keep your eyes open for the entrance, which is a short walk off the dirt road.

    Public Transportation

    Catch a local bus from Rock Sound heading towards Tarpum Bay. Inform the driver that you want to get off at the nearest stop to Cathedral Cave. After approximately 10 minutes, ask the driver to let you off at the fork in the road. From there, you will need to walk about a mile down the dirt road to the cave entrance. Look for signs along the way to guide you.

    Discover more about Cathedral Cave

    Cathedral Cave, located in the picturesque Rock Sound, is a mesmerizing natural preserve that beckons travelers from far and wide. This stunning cave is renowned for its towering limestone formations and crystal-clear turquoise waters, creating a breathtaking backdrop for anyone eager to explore. The cave's vast chambers and intricate rock patterns are not only a testament to nature's artistry but also provide a fascinating glimpse into the geological history of the Bahamas. Visitors can wander through the caverns, marveling at the impressive stalactites and stalagmites that adorn the walls, all while basking in the serene atmosphere that envelops the space.
